本文目录导读:
随着互联网技术的飞速发展,企业对IT架构的依赖程度越来越高,在过去的几十年里,集中式架构因其简单、稳定、易于管理等特点,成为了企业IT架构的主流,随着业务规模的不断扩大和复杂性的增加,集中式架构逐渐暴露出其局限性,如单点故障、扩展性差、资源利用率低等问题,许多企业开始考虑将集中式架构转型为分布式架构,本文将探讨集中式架构向分布式架构转型过程中需要注意的关键问题,并提出相应的应对策略。
图片来源于网络,如有侵权联系删除
集中式架构与分布式架构的差异
1、架构风格
集中式架构:采用单点或多点中心化的架构风格,所有数据和计算资源集中在中心节点,通过中心节点进行数据存储、处理和传输。
分布式架构:采用去中心化的架构风格,将数据和计算资源分散在多个节点上,各节点之间通过网络进行协同工作。
2、扩展性
集中式架构:扩展性较差,当业务规模扩大时,需要升级中心节点或增加节点数量,且升级过程中可能会出现单点故障。
分布式架构:具有良好的扩展性,通过增加节点数量或提高节点性能,可以实现水平扩展和垂直扩展。
3、资源利用率
集中式架构:资源利用率较低,中心节点可能存在资源浪费或不足的情况。
分布式架构:资源利用率较高,通过合理分配和调度资源,可以实现资源的最大化利用。
4、高可用性
集中式架构:高可用性较低,中心节点故障可能导致整个系统瘫痪。
分布式架构:高可用性较高,通过冗余设计和故障转移机制,可以实现系统的持续运行。
图片来源于网络,如有侵权联系删除
三、集中式架构向分布式架构转型过程中的关键问题
1、技术选型
在转型过程中,需要选择合适的分布式技术,如分布式数据库、分布式缓存、分布式消息队列等,技术选型不当可能导致系统性能下降、维护难度增加等问题。
2、数据迁移
数据迁移是转型过程中的关键环节,需要确保数据的一致性和完整性,若数据迁移失败,可能导致业务中断。
3、系统兼容性
转型过程中,需要确保新架构与现有系统兼容,避免因兼容性问题导致业务中断。
4、安全性问题
分布式架构存在安全隐患,如数据泄露、恶意攻击等,在转型过程中,需要加强安全防护措施。
5、人员培训
转型过程中,需要加强团队成员对分布式技术的培训,提高团队整体技术水平。
应对策略
1、深入调研,合理选型
图片来源于网络,如有侵权联系删除
在转型前,充分了解各类分布式技术的优缺点,结合企业实际情况,选择合适的分布式技术。
2、制定详细的数据迁移方案
在数据迁移过程中,制定详细的数据迁移方案,确保数据的一致性和完整性。
3、确保系统兼容性
在转型过程中,关注系统兼容性问题,确保新架构与现有系统无缝对接。
4、加强安全防护
在转型过程中,加强安全防护措施,如数据加密、访问控制、入侵检测等,降低安全隐患。
5、加强团队培训
组织团队成员参加分布式技术培训,提高团队整体技术水平。
集中式架构向分布式架构转型是一个复杂的过程,需要企业充分了解自身需求,选择合适的转型策略,在转型过程中,关注关键问题,采取有效措施,才能确保转型顺利进行,为企业带来更高的效益。
标签: #集中式架构转分布式架构注意哪些问题
评论列表